我想知道为什么这个函数在最后打印"None“,即使字典只有3个键。
def groups(group_dictionary):
i = 0
for group in group_dictionary:
print(group)
print(i)
i = i+1
print(groups({"local": ["admin", "userA"], "public": ["admin", "userB"], "
两个函数A,F之间的区别是什么?
抱歉,我使用mysql而不是mysqli或PDO
function A ($B){
if($result = mysql_query("SELECT C FROM D WHERE E"))
{
if ($row = mysql_fetch_array($result))
{
return $text = $row['C'];
}
return 0;
}
return 0;
}
还有这一条:
function F (
class A
{
private ?string $x = null;
public function getX(): ?null
{
return $this->x;
}
}
class B
{
public function __construct(string $y)
{
// Property initialization...
}
}
$a = new A();
if ($a->getX() !== null) {
$b = new B($a->getX());
有关出现问题的系统的信息:
操作系统:Debian8.1 64位- MySQL版本: 5.5.44 - GCC: 4.9.2
我正在创建一个简单的UDF函数,它将返回字符串Hello。问题是,它将返回Hello,连接到它,有一个长的随机二进制字符串,具有可变大小的随机数据,这将从执行到执行。
hello_world.c
#ifdef STANDARD
/* STANDARD is defined,
don't use any mysql functions */
#include <stdlib.h>
#include <stdio.h>
#include &
我正在制作自己的CMS。我有一些选择要在页面上回显的数据库行的代码,如下所示:
$query = mysql_query("SELECT * FROM posts order by id desc") or die(mysql_error());
但是,每当我尝试将其放入函数中并调用该函数,而不是使用那么长的代码行时,什么都不会发生。我是不是遗漏了一些PHP函数?
function posts() {
mysql_query("SELECT * FROM posts order by id desc") or die(mysql_error());
我想从这个异步函数exports.getServices中获取返回值。但我什么也得不到/空值返回。
var http = require("http");
var mysql = require('mysql');
var url = require("url");
var connection = mysql.createConnection({
...
});
connection.connect();
exp
嗨,我在使用Devart时遇到了这种异常。我在MySql中调用一个存储过程。Store procedure函数,如果我通过DB调用它。
using (dc = conn.GetContext())
{
result = dc.StoreProcedure(pId).FirstOrDefault();
}
return result;
[MySqlException (0x80004005): You have an error in your SQL syntax; check the manual that corresponds to your M
这是我在main()程序的开始。第一个输入请求是在用户应该键入输入的空格中打印“None”。用户仍然能够键入输入,但我无法摆脱‘无’。
我尝试修改返回语句位于while语句末尾的位置,这不会影响任何事情(现在它只是被删除了,但是即使包含它,它仍然返回None)。我没有要求它打印两次(据我所知)。
while True:
start = input(str(print('Would you like to find out your USA weather forecast? Please enter YES or NO.\n')))
if start.upper
我想从MySQL表中获取一个变量,并根据变量的值打开我的web应用程序窗口。我在应用程序的服务器端编写了MySQL连接查询。因此,当建立服务器连接时,可能会发生上述流。但是在获取变量值后,代码不会向前运行,在调试模式下,光标结束于y的返回值。请帮助解决此问题。提前谢谢。
#!/usr/bin/env node
'use strict';
require('dotenv').config({silent: true});
var server = require('./app');
var port = process.env.PORT ||
在片段着色器中,以下内容可以很好地编译:
uniform isampler2D testTexture;
/* in main() x, y, xoff and yoff are declared as int and assigned here, then... */
int tmp = texelFetchOffset(testTexture, ivec2(x, y), 0, ivec2(xoff, yoff)).r;
然而,以下内容没有编译:
uniform usampler2D testTexture;
/* in main() x, y, xoff and yoff are decl
在我的includes文件夹中,我有一个函数...
function storelistingUno() {
$itemnum=mysql_real_escape_string($_POST['itemnum']);
$msrp=mysql_real_escape_string($_POST['msrp']);
$edprice=mysql_real_escape_string($_POST['edprice']); //This value has to be the same as in the HTML form file
$itemty
我正在尝试创建一个函数来获取数据库表(platforms)中的所有行,该函数将每个行名(platform_name)插入到一个数组中。这应该会在我的HTML文档中输出一个行列表。
相关代码如下:
var getData = new function() {
this.query = 'SELECT * FROM platforms';
this.exe = function() {
// Connecting to MySQL Database
var mysql = r